About the course
The Master of Theological Studies (MTS) provides postgraduate study in theology within a Catholic university setting and an Ecclesiastical Faculty partnership. You will build foundations in theology while developing critical analysis and faith-informed inquiry through studies in philosophy, Sacred Scripture, Catholic theology and related disciplines. The program includes a core course and electives, with an optional research component. This is a Masters program in theological studies.
Career outcome
Graduates can apply theological knowledge and communication skills across church and community contexts. The degree supports pathways into roles involving ministry preparation, catechesis and faith formation, pastoral and parish work, education support, and service in Catholic agencies and not-for-profits. It also provides a basis for further theological study or research, and for contributing to public life through informed engagement with scripture, doctrine and ethics.
